How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Schenectady?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Schenectady Studio Apartments with Utilities Included | $1,081 | $810 | $1,698 |
| Schenectady 1 Bedroom Apartments with Utilities Included | $1,470 | $910 | $2,095 |
| Schenectady 2 Bedroom Apartments with Utilities Included | $1,785 | $986 | $3,450 |
| Schenectady 3 Bedroom Apartments with Utilities Included | $2,039 | $1,500 | $2,725 |
| Schenectady 4 Bedroom Apartments with Utilities Included | $1,570 | $750 | $2,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included Schenectady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included Schenectady Apartment?
The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in Schenectady is $1,562.
What is the largest Utilities Included Schenectady Apartment for rent?
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in Schenectady is a 1,675 square feet unit starting from $1,400 at River House Apartments.
What is the average size for Schenectady Utilities Included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Utilities Included rental in Schenectady is currently at 753 sq ft.
